Product Description

 

White Powder Fmoc-n-me-val-Osu CAS NO. 863971-49-7 Purity 98+

 

Name: Fmoc-n-me-val-Osu

CAS NO: 863971-49-7

M.W: 450.48

Appearance: White Powder

Purity: 98+   

Synonyms: L-Valine, N-[(9H-fluoren-9-ylmethoxy)carbonyl]-N-methyl-, 2,5-dioxo-1-pyrrolidinyl ester

 

Application

 

FMOC-N-Me-Val-OSU is a commonly used protected amino acid derivative for solid-phase peptide synthesis. It is widely applied in organic chemistry, peptide synthesis, and drug discovery.

 

In peptide synthesis, FMOC-N-Me-Val-OSU serves as a common protected amino acid derivative for the synthesis of peptides with specific sequences. Due to the stability of its protecting group towards side reactions such as oxidation, hydrolysis, and decarboxylation, FMOC-N-Me-Val-OSU effectively prevents these reactions, thereby improving the efficiency and purity of peptide synthesis.

 

Moreover, FMOC-N-Me-Val-OSU can also be used in organic chemistry for synthetic reactions. With its stable protecting group and good reactivity, FMOC-N-Me-Val-OSU can serve as a synthetic intermediate for the synthesis of other compounds of significant interest.

 

In the field of drug discovery, the application of FMOC-N-Me-Val-OSU is also extensive. Peptide drugs are a class of compounds with important biological activities, and their synthesis often requires amino acid derivatives as synthetic intermediates. FMOC-N-Me-Val-OSU can serve as a synthetic intermediate for the synthesis of peptide drugs with specific sequences and functions.
